The number of people working past the age of 50 is on the rise. According to the Office for National Statistics, workers aged 50 and over made up nearly 80 per cent of employment growth over the past decade. Living longer, coupled with inadequate pensions and savings, means that for many older workers, retirement is still years away from a reality.
